最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E
标题:Cursor引领未来编程新时代,AI赋能开发者的无限可能
在当今快速发展的科技时代,编程已经成为推动社会进步的重要力量。然而,对于许多开发者来说,编程过程仍然充满了挑战和复杂性。为了应对这些挑战,越来越多的智能工具应运而生,其中最引人注目的当属Cursor。本文将探讨Cursor如何改变编程方式,并通过与InsCode AI IDE的对比,展示其应用场景和巨大价值,引导读者下载这一革命性的工具。
Cursor:AI驱动的编程助手
Cursor是一款由AI技术驱动的集成开发环境(IDE),旨在为开发者提供高效、便捷且智能化的编程体验。它不仅能够帮助开发者更快地编写代码,还能通过内置的AI对话框实现代码补全、修改项目代码、生成注释等功能。无论你是编程初学者还是经验丰富的开发者,Cursor都能显著提升你的工作效率。
应用场景一:简化代码生成
传统的编程过程中,开发者需要花费大量时间来编写基础代码,尤其是在处理复杂的业务逻辑时。Cursor通过内置的AI对话框,使得代码生成变得更加简单。开发者只需输入自然语言描述,Cursor就能自动生成相应的代码片段。例如,在开发一个图书借阅系统时,开发者可以简单地告诉Cursor:“我需要一个用户登录功能”,Cursor就会根据需求生成完整的登录模块代码,包括前端界面和后端逻辑。
这种基于自然语言的代码生成方式,极大地简化了编程过程,让开发者能够专注于创意和设计,而不是繁琐的编码细节。同时,Cursor还支持全局代码生成/改写,理解整个项目并生成或修改多个文件,甚至可以生成图片资源,进一步提升了开发效率。
应用场景二:智能问答与代码解析
编程不仅仅是编写代码,还包括理解和优化现有代码。Cursor的智能问答功能允许用户通过自然对话与之互动,以应对编程领域的多种挑战。无论是代码解析、语法指导,还是优化建议、编写测试案例,Cursor都能提供全面的支持。
例如,当你遇到一段难以理解的代码时,你可以直接询问Cursor:“这段代码的作用是什么?” Cursor会立即为你解释代码逻辑,并提供详细的注释。如果你发现代码中存在性能瓶颈,Cursor还可以分析代码,给出优化建议,帮助你提高程序的运行效率。
此外,Cursor还具备快速添加代码注释的能力,支持在任意代码文件中快速添加中文或英文注释,提升代码的可读性和维护性。这不仅有助于团队协作,还能让你在未来回顾代码时更加轻松。
应用场景三:自动化测试与错误修复
编写高质量的代码离不开充分的测试和错误修复。Cursor内置的单元测试生成功能可以帮助开发者快速验证代码的准确性,提高代码的测试覆盖率和质量。通过简单的命令,Cursor可以自动生成单元测试用例,确保每个功能模块都经过严格的测试。
当代码中出现错误时,Cursor也能迅速响应。它可以通过分析错误信息,提供具体的修改建议,帮助开发者快速定位并修复问题。这种自动化的错误修复机制,不仅节省了时间和精力,还能有效减少人为错误的发生。
Cursor与InsCode AI IDE的比较
尽管Cursor已经展示了强大的功能和应用价值,但市场上还有其他优秀的AI编程工具,如InsCode AI IDE。作为优快云、GitCode和华为云CodeArts IDE联合开发的产品,InsCode AI IDE同样致力于为开发者提供高效、便捷的编程体验。
InsCode AI IDE不仅具备类似的AI对话框、代码生成、智能问答等功能,还在架构上进行了深度优化。它结合了Web、本地和特定语言技术的优势,通过Electron将JavaScript、Node.js等Web技术与本地应用程序相结合,实现了强大的跨平台支持。此外,InsCode AI IDE还集成了DeepSeek-V3模型,能够更精准地理解开发者的需求,提供个性化的代码优化建议。
相比之下,InsCode AI IDE在某些方面具有更大的优势。例如,它支持更多编程语言和框架,提供了更丰富的扩展插件生态,以及更完善的源代码版本控制功能。因此,如果你正在寻找一款功能强大且易于使用的AI编程工具,InsCode AI IDE无疑是一个值得考虑的选择。
结语
无论是Cursor还是InsCode AI IDE,这些智能化的工具都在不断推动编程方式的变革。它们不仅简化了代码生成和修改的过程,还通过智能问答、代码解析、自动化测试等功能,提升了开发效率和代码质量。如果你希望在未来的编程工作中获得更多便利和创新,不妨下载并试用InsCode AI IDE,感受AI带来的无限可能。
现在就行动吧,开启你的智能编程之旅!
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考